code of ethics and good practice for children's sportChild Protection

DLR Leisure Services has a legal and moral responsibility to create and maintain the safest possible environment for children to enjoy sports and other recreational, social and leisure pursuits provided directly by us. DLR Leisure Services accepts that in all matters concerning child protection, the welfare and protection of the young person is paramount. We will adhere to the Children First National Guidelines for the Protection and Welfare of Children.

Any person who suspects that a child is being abused, or is at risk of abuse, has a responsibility and a duty of care to report their concerns to the Child Protection Liaison Office for each DLR Leisure Centre.

Our policy is given in more detail in the document referenced in the following section.
